There is a Russian school in Raleigh, maybe they could recommend someone? Znaika – Russian school in Raleigh, NC

Also there are many tutors who offer services by Skype. Those would be native speakers and the rate would be definitely cheaper than locally. Don’t have any specific recommendations but I’m sure Google can find something on this.

There are also local Russian speaking groups on meetup, look it up. If not tutoring it would be good for speaking practice IMHO.
